Player transitions refer to the processes and activities involved when an athlete moves from one phase of their career or status to another. This can include transitions from amateur to professional status, moving between teams, shifting from one position to another, or adapting to changes in roles within a team. It often encompasses the psychological, social, and physical adjustments a player must make during these changes, as well as the support systems in place to facilitate these transitions. Player transitions are significant in sports management and athlete development, focusing on ensuring that players can navigate these changes successfully while maintaining performance and well-being.
